Text: | How Sweet the Name of Jesus Sounds |
Author: | John Newton |
Tune: | ORTONVILLE |
Composer: | Thomas Hastings |
1 How sweet the name of Jesus sounds
In a believer's ear!
It soothes his sorrows, heals his wounds,
And drives away his fear,
And drives away his fear.
2 It makes the wounded spirit whole
And calms the troubled breast;
'Tis manna to the hungry soul,
And to the weary, rest,
And to the weary, rest.
3 Dear name– the rock on which I build,
My shield and hiding place;
My never failing treasure, filled
With boundless stores of grace,
With boundless stores of grace!
4 Jesus, my shepherd, brother, friend,
My prophet, priest and King.
My Lord, my life, my way, my end,
Accept the praise I bring,
Accept the praise I bring.
